Who Needs This Bond?
If you operate a business or organization that has been approved — or is seeking approval — by the Washington State Department of Licensing to administer CDL skills tests as a third-party tester, this bond is required. Trucking companies, driver training schools, and other entities that conduct behind-the-wheel CDL examinations outside of a state testing site fall into this category. You cannot legally test CDL applicants in Washington as a third-party tester without this bond on file with the state.
What is this Bond For?
Washington requires CDL Third Party Testers to carry this surety bond to protect the integrity of the commercial driver licensing process. It holds your testing organization accountable for following state-mandated examination procedures and reporting requirements. If your organization administers tests fraudulently, fails to meet standards, or causes harm through non-compliance, the bond provides a financial remedy to the Washington State Department of Licensing. It's a condition of your authority to test — not optional.
When is it Required?
Renewal of your third-party tester authorization means your bond must remain continuously active — a lapse can trigger suspension of your testing privileges. You must have this bond in place before the Department of Licensing will issue or renew your third-party tester agreement. Anytime your authorization status changes — new location, new agreement cycle, or reinstatement after suspension — bond compliance is part of the process. Where Does it Apply?
This bond is a statewide Washington requirement enforced by the Washington State Department of Licensing. It applies to every third-party CDL skills testing operation conducting examinations anywhere within the state of Washington. There is no local or county-level variation — the requirement is uniform across Washington.
